Transaction 7fad49f3b057461253bc2f26c22ff5726b0e3e183f181880c5e3386608b58402

4 Input
1 Outputs
  • 7fad49f3b057461253bc2f26c22ff5726b0e3e183f181880c5e3386608b58402:0
  • value  12405186
    address  3CNTzkkT3E1HvjBJMFfFZ4T2RBM7vPB4iH